CV Tips for Hotel Receptionists

As a Hotel Receptionist, your CV is a reflection of your ability to provide excellent customer service, manage multiple tasks, and maintain a professional demeanor. It should highlight your interpersonal skills, attention to detail, and proficiency in hotel management software. An effective CV will demonstrate your ability to create a welcoming environment for guests, handle administrative tasks, and resolve issues promptly and efficiently.

Whether you're seeking a role in a boutique hotel, a luxury resort, or a busy city hotel, these guidelines will help make your CV stand out to employers.

  • Highlight Your Customer Service Skills: Mention specific instances where you've gone above and beyond to provide exceptional service to guests. This could include resolving complaints, accommodating special requests, or receiving positive guest feedback.
  • Showcase Your Multitasking Abilities: Detail situations where you've successfully juggled multiple tasks at once, such as managing check-ins and check-outs while handling phone inquiries and administrative duties.
  • Customize Your CV to the Role: Tailor your CV to match the specific requirements of the job description, emphasizing relevant experiences and skills such as fluency in multiple languages or expertise in a particular hotel management system.
  • Detail Your Proficiency in Hotel Management Software: List your experience with software like Opera, RoomMaster, or Cloudbeds. If you're proficient in any other relevant software or systems, be sure to include them.
  • Demonstrate Your Interpersonal and Communication Skills: Provide examples of how you've used your communication skills to improve guest experiences, resolve conflicts, or work effectively with your team.

    How to Format a Hotel Receptionist CV

    In the hospitality industry, the role of a Hotel Receptionist is pivotal, and the formatting of your CV can significantly impact your chances of landing the job. A well-structured CV not only reflects your professionalism but also makes it easier for hiring managers to understand your skills and experience. Proper formatting can be the deciding factor in securing an interview, showcasing your attention to detail and organizational skills, both of which are crucial for a Hotel Receptionist.

    Start with a Compelling Profile

    Begin your CV with a compelling profile that outlines your career goals and how you plan to contribute to the prospective hotel. This should be a concise summary of your skills, experience, and passion for the hospitality industry. Highlighting your commitment to providing excellent customer service and your ability to handle challenging situations will set a positive tone for the rest of your CV.

    Highlight Relevant Skills and Experience

    As a Hotel Receptionist, your skills and experience are your most valuable assets. Format this section to list your most relevant skills at the top, such as customer service, communication, problem-solving, and proficiency in hotel management software. Follow this with a detailed account of your work experience, focusing on roles where you've demonstrated these skills. This layout allows hiring managers to quickly assess your suitability for the role.

    Detail Your Education and Training

    While practical experience is crucial, your education and training also play a significant role. List any degrees or certifications related to hospitality management, customer service, or business administration. If you've undergone specific training in hotel management software or languages, be sure to include these details. Use bullet points to make this section easy to read and understand.

    Emphasize Multilingual Skills and Personal Attributes

    In the hospitality industry, being multilingual can be a significant advantage. If you speak more than one language, highlight this skill prominently on your CV. Additionally, personal attributes like patience, resilience, and a friendly demeanor are highly valued in a Hotel Receptionist. Include a section that balances both, showing that you're not only capable of handling the technical aspects of the job but also excel in interpersonal communication. Remember, a well-formatted CV can make a significant difference in your job search. Use these tips to create a CV that showcases your skills and experience in the best possible light.

    CV FAQs for Hotel Receptionists

    How long should Hotel Receptionists make a CV?

    The ideal length for a Hotel Receptionist's CV is 1-2 pages. This allows sufficient room to showcase your skills, experience, and accomplishments in the hospitality industry without overloading with unnecessary details. Prioritize clarity and relevance, emphasizing your most notable achievements in hotel reception or customer service roles that align closely with the position you're applying for.

    What's the best format for an Hotel Receptionist CV?

    The best format for a Hotel Receptionist CV is typically the reverse-chronological format. This layout highlights your most recent and relevant hospitality experiences first, showcasing your career progression and key achievements. It allows employers to quickly see your growth in customer service and administrative skills. Each section should be tailored to emphasize reception-specific skills, language proficiencies, and accomplishments, aligning closely with the job description.
